Original Description
Patrick William Adam’s Ardilea, North Berwick is a captivating example of Scottish Post-Impressionism, blending luminous color and serene atmosphere to evoke the quiet beauty of coastal East Lothian. Painted around the early 20th century, the work showcases Adam’s mastery of capturing light and mood—soft brushstrokes animate the landscape, while delicate harmonies of greens, blues, and earthy tones reflect the natural tranquility of Ardilea’s gardens. As a key figure in the Glasgow School’s later generation, Adam bridged Impressionist influences with a uniquely Scottish sensibility, making this piece historically significant for its contribution to Britain’s rural landscape tradition. The painting’s quiet intimacy and tonal richness place it among his finest works, offering viewers a window into both the locale’s charm and the artist’s refined aesthetic.
